Earl Abbott was credited with shooting down 4.75 enemy aircraft in aerial action during World War II.

    Headquarters, 8th Air Force, General Orders No. 37 (March 6, 1945)

    (Citation Needed) – SYNOPSIS: The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ress July 9, 1918, takes pride in presenting the Silver Star (Posthumously) to Major (Air Corps) Earl Leroy Abbott (ASN: 0-660038), United States Army Air Forces, for gallantry in action against the enemy while serving as a Pilot of a Fighter Airplane with the 328th Fighter Squadron, 352d Fighter Group, EIGHTH Air Force, in aerial action over the European Theater of Operations, in 1945. The gallant actions and dedicated devotion to duty demonstrated by Major Abbott, without regard for his own life, were in keeping with the highest traditions of military service and reflect great credit upon himself and the United States Army Air Forces.
